World’s oldest serving aircraft carrier INS Viraat retires today

The World’s oldest aircraft carrier in active service, INS Viraat will be decommissioned on 6 March 2017. The iconic carrier will receive a ceremonial send off in Mumbai. Similar to the decommissioning of INS Vikrant, India’s first aircraft carrier in January 1997, INS Viraat send off would be an emotional moment for the novel officers and other personnel who were deployed on the ship.


Sam Querrey beats Rafael Nadal in Mexico Open Final

Sam Querrey beat a 14-time Grand Slam Champion Rafael Nadal in straight sets to claim the ATP Mexico Open hold on 4th March. The American Clinched the final 6-3, 7-6 to secure the title despite being unseeded and ranked No 40 in the World Querrey 29, beat Nadal for the first time in five meetings between the pair.

West Bengal Govt grants Official language status to Kurukh

The West Bengal Government granted Official language status to endangered tribal language Kurukh. The official language status was given to the endangered language by the state government in February 2017. However, the announcement was recently made by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ee.
